如何检查IP是否可以在网络中使用?

时间:2011-07-01 08:27:42

标签: android networking

我有一个使用UDP广播的IP列表, 所以在Alive / Death数据包的基础上,我知道用户是活着还是已经离开。

但我有一个案例,假设用户在发送死亡数据包之前从网络出去, 然后我该如何检测用户是否有效。

- 我的解决方案:

所以为此我运行了一个线程,我在其中向所有用户发送一个虚拟数据(来自ip list),所以如果没有ip,那么它会响应IO异常。 但它花了很多时间在网络中识别ip。

请告诉我是否有更快的解决方案。

1 个答案:

答案 0 :(得分:1)

尝试ping:

Ping

和本文:

Java Ping command

希望这有帮助